mItSuBiShI eVo pDrM


Polis Di Raja Malaysia (PDRM) dilaporkan telah membeli 25 unit kereta sport mewah Mitsubishi Lancer Evolution dengan transmisi manual dipercayai untuk kegunaan rasmi polis.

Kereta baru ini akan digunakan seiringan dengan kereta rasmi polis sedia ada seperti Proton Waja & Proton Iswara. Namun, kereta sport mewah idaman ramai anak muda zaman sekarang ini dikhabarkan akan digunakan untuk aktiviti penyamaran (undercover). Kemungkinan juga ianya lebih kepada kegiatan kejar mengejar, bukan untuk tujuan escort.

Jadinya, kita tidak akan nampak sebarang Lancer Evo dengan lambang polis dalam masa terdekat ini. Bagaimana agaknya rupa kereta Mitsubishi Lancer Evo versi polis? Nantikannya.

Untuk rekod, pasukan polis Jepun sudah menggunakan kereta jenama ini sebagai kegunaan rasmi pasukan mereka. Manakala, polis Jerman menggunakan kereta berjenama Lamborgini Gallardo, polis Perancis menggunakan kereta berjenama Peageut Sports GT, polis Sepanyol menggunakan kereta berjenama Audi TT, dan polis England menggunakan kereta berjenama Porsche.

KUALA LUMPUR: The Royal Malaysian police has bought 25 high-powered Mitsubishi Lancer Evolution cars to catch criminals and speed hogs.

The cars, worth several millions of ringgit, would be fitted with safety gadgets and would sport the looks of police patrol cars.

Sources said the police had al­­ready taken possession and were testing the cars before sending them to the Road Transport Depart­ment for registration and approval.

“The cars are to be used in high-speed car chase, especially in cases of carjacking, kidnapping and hi­­jacking.

“The speed of the cars would enable the police to catch up with criminals who often used modified turbo charged cars to escape,” they said.

Several police personnel have been sent to undergo intensive driving classes to ensure they are able to handle the super charged cars, they added.

The cars, they said, would also be used by the highway patrol unit to monitor speed hogs or illegal racers.

Inspector-General of Police Tan Sri Musa Hassan confirmed the purchase but declined to elaborate.
